Filtration system installation services involve setting up specialized units that improve the quality of water or air within a property. These systems are designed to remove contaminants, sediments, and impurities, ensuring cleaner and safer water or air for everyday use. Whether it’s a whole-house water filter, an air purification system, or a combination of both, experienced service providers can assess the specific needs of a property and install the right filtration solutions to enhance overall health and comfort.
Many common problems prompt property owners to seek filtration system installation. These include unpleasant tastes or odors in tap water, visible sediment or particles, or concerns about chemicals and pollutants. For indoor air quality, issues like allergies, mold, or lingering odors can signal the need for a filtration upgrade. Installing a proper filtration system can help address these issues by reducing harmful substances, improving clarity, and creating a healthier environment for residents.
Properties that typically use filtration systems vary widely but often include single-family homes, apartment buildings, and small commercial spaces. Homes with well water or older plumbing may benefit from water filtration to prevent mineral buildup and improve taste. Commercial properties or multi-unit residences might require larger or more advanced air and water filtration solutions to meet health standards and provide a better quality of life for occupants. The overview below groups typical Filtration System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Muncie,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or filtration system repairs or component replacements in Muncie often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um. Local contractors can usually handle these efficiently and affordably.
Standard Installation - Installing a new filtration system gener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the system type and complexity. Most projects in this category are priced within this range, with larger or more complex setups potentially exceeding $3,500.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ire filtration system can cost from $2,500 to $5,000 or more, especially for high-end or commercial-grade units. Many replacements fall into the middle of this range, but larger properties or custom solutions may push costs higher.
Complex or Custom Projects - Advanced filtration system installations or custom setups can reach $5,000+ depending on the scope and specifications. These projects are less common and tend to be on the higher end of the cost spectrum, requiring specialized expertise from local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of filtration systems can local contractors install? They can install a variety of filtration systems, including whole-house filters, under-sink units, and point-of-use filters, tailored to specific water quality needs.
How do I know if a filtration system is suitable for my home? Local service providers can assess your water quality and household requirements to recommend appropriate filtration options.
What is involved in the installation process? Installation typically includes assessing the existing plumbing, selecting the right system, and properly connecting it to ensure effective filtration.
Can filtration systems be integrated with existing plumbing? Yes, experienced contractors can integrate new filtration units with existing plumbing setups for seamless operation.
Are there different filtration systems for specific concerns like sediment or chemicals? Yes, local pros can install systems designed to target particular issues such as sediment, chlorine, or other contaminants present in your water supply.
